Work in your element. At Oleon, we bring you natural chemistry. Ambitious, with both feet on the ground. That’s who we are and that’s how we will continue to grow. Our specialty lies in converting natural fats and oils into a wide range of oleochemical products. We offer them in a large variety of markets such as cosmetics, nutrition, crop protection, industrial ingredients, lubricants, oilfield, coatings, detergents, and many more. Oleon has over 1,000 employees worldwide in 10 different countries. Enthusiastic people who are completely in their element here at Oleon are more than welcome to join our team.

Some of your main duties & responsibilities:

  • Support the Logistics Coordinator with the scheduling and processing of deliveries nationally and internationally of bulk, IBC and palletised refined oils / specialty products through Oleon Fleet and 3rd party logistics providers to achieve the daily delivery plan.
  • Ensure deliveries are booked in efficiently with customers to achieve the delivery schedule provided by the Logistics Coordinator.
  • Work closely with our 3PL providers to maximise performance, drive efficiency and highlight any decline in performance.
  • Support the Logistics Coordinator to identify solutions and contingency plans for any delivery issues.
  • Manage all activities associated with returnable transit packaging (IBC’s).
  • Prepare relevant transport documentation, including commercial invoices and packing lists, required to export goods.
  • Understand and arrange shipment of dangerous goods, ensuring the relevant documentation is provided in a timely manner.
  • Raise & receipt transport purchase orders for deliveries executed on 3rd party hauliers.
  • Resolve any invoice queries relating to 3rd party haulier deliveries.
  • Be involved in the process to ensure import clearance for inbound international stock replenishments.
  • Daily dialog with the Logistics Fleet team to co-ordinate delivery operations.
  • Provide cover as required for the Logistics Coordinator / Logistics Administrator within the team.
